 Your role at RBI

  • Continuously learn and improve data science and data analytics skills and be data-driven in your everyday work; 
  • Enhance regulatory know-how around selected regulatory developments, including regulations on data, AI, etc; 
  • Deep dive into supervisory processes and exercises to work on use-cases for data structure and AI application;  
  • Support development and maintain "Regulatory radar" tool (monitoring, communication and analysis) of RBI Group relevant regulatory initiatives; 
  • Support and enhance other team's tools (SharePoint Pages, Lists and Libraries, Jira Boards, PowerAutomate, PowerBI); 
  • Be part of various discovery projects and AI use-cases; 
  • Develop Power BI reports for various data sets of the team.   


Your core competencies

  • University degree in law, economics, IT or comparable studies  
  • Knowledge of international and European regulatory frameworks (legislative process, EU institutions) 
  • Understanding corner stones of the Banks Supervisory Framework in EU 
  • Diligence and attention to detail in legal texts and text-based data 
  • Analytical skills, quick-wittedness, drive for solutions, team-orientation 
  • Basic knowledge of coding languages like Python, R, SQL and Scala, along with products like Tableau, Power BI, Oracle SQL and Excel 
  • Ability to handle complex assignments under time pressure.
